- The distance between Krasnoyarsk, Russia and Birao, Central African Republic is approximately 7,829 km or 4,865 mi.
- To reach Krasnoyarsk in this distance one would set out from Birao bearing 33.9°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Krasnoyarsk bearing 79.1° or E .
- Krasnoyarsk has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Birao has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Krasnoyarsk is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Birao is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 25.7 °C (46.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 30 °C (54°F) more in Krasnoyarsk.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 422 mm (16.6 in) less which is equivalent to 422 l/m² (10.36 US gal/ft²) or 4,220,000 l/ha (451,146 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- There are 1192 fewer hours of sunlight per year in Krasnoyarsk. In whichever way circa 3h 16' less per day or about 3/5 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 39.5° lower in Krasnoyarsk than in Birao.
- Relative humidity levels are 29.5%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 13.6°C (24.5°F) lower.
